MrLoathsome was all about Co-op and team games, so think with that in mind.
He liked monsters to be a challenge but not spam (hence he didn't play MonsterHunt very often).
Speaking of SPiced hAM, he loved bacon on everything.
Mooooo was his greeting and battlecry (possibly due to an accident with a teleporter and a Nali Cow).

His dropper mods were one of his most underused mods. The ability to chain what actor will drop from what pawn when you kill it, means you can have a Russian dolls monster, endlessly releasing another different monster, or til you think is sane.
We joked that you could start with a Queen or Titan and eventually you finally reveal a harmless rabbit that was at the controls all along.
Kill the rabbit and drop a "whatever you want". A pickup, a bowl of flowers, or an event trigger.....
He really wanted people to make good use of it and get creative, but I don't think people get the idea these days without a video.

Dr.Flay wrote: His dropper mods were one of his most underused mods. The ability to chain what actor will drop from what pawn when you kill it, means you can have a Russian dolls monster, endlessly releasing another different monster, or til you think is sane.
Not everyone is agree with this because it's not a really sane way of doing:

Code: Select all

class Pawn extends Actor 
	abstract
	native
	nativereplication;
...
// Inventory to drop when killed (for creatures)
var() class<inventory> DropWhenKilled;
Perhaps a pawn cannot call whatever is set for an Inventory and is neither advisable changing remote-role,

Code: Select all

class GameInfo extends Info
	native;
...
	if( Other.DropWhenKilled != None )
	{
		dropped = Spawn(Other.DropWhenKilled,,,Other.Location);
		Inv = Inventory(dropped); //Null for Other stuff
		if ( Inv != None )
		{ 
			Inv.RespawnTime = 0.0; //don't respawn
			Inv.BecomePickup();		
		}
		if ( dropped != None )
		{
			dropped.RemoteRole = ROLE_DumbProxy; //NAH !
			dropped.SetPhysics(PHYS_Falling); //I hope everything is nice in water  :loool: 
			dropped.bCollideWorld = true;
			dropped.Velocity = Other.Velocity + VRand() * 280;
		}
		if ( Inv != None )
			Inv.GotoState('PickUp', 'Dropped');
	}
here is recommended definitely to be used an Inventory - exactly like in decorations. But... nvm right now...
